She was referred to as Mistress Shaw. She was, in fact, the slave of Mr Shaw. However, he considered himself to be in love with her. So they were living "at home" as common-law husband and wife. But, since interracial marriages were not legally recognized, their arrangement was very much strictly restricted to the grounds of his land. In addition, since "Mistress Shaw", as a legal slave, did not in fact have the actual legal capacity to say no to Mr Shaw, their relationship was still "morally" predicated on RAPE. Regardless of whether Mr Shaw considered himself to be in love with her. Lastly, the short answer to your original question, she was simply something of a confidant and mentor to neighboring slave Patsey.
